def test_set_expiry(azure):
    with azure_teardown(azure):
        # this future time gives the milliseconds since the epoch that have occured as of 01/31/2030 at noon
        epoch_time = datetime.datetime.utcfromtimestamp(0)
        final_time = datetime.datetime(2030, 1, 31, 12)
        time_in_milliseconds = (final_time - epoch_time).total_seconds() * 1000

        # create the file
        azure.touch(a)

        # first get the existing expiry, which should be never
        initial_expiry = azure.info(a,
                                    invalidate_cache=True)['msExpirationTime']
        azure.set_expiry(a, 'Absolute', time_in_milliseconds)
        cur_expiry = azure.info(a, invalidate_cache=True)['msExpirationTime']
        # this is a range of +- 100ms because the service does a best effort to set it precisely, but there is
        # no guarantee that the expiry will be to the exact millisecond
        assert time_in_milliseconds - 100 <= cur_expiry <= time_in_milliseconds + 100
        assert initial_expiry != cur_expiry

        # now set it back to never expire and validate it is the same
        azure.set_expiry(a, 'NeverExpire')
        cur_expiry = azure.info(a)['msExpirationTime']
        assert initial_expiry == cur_expiry

        # now validate the fail cases
        # bad enum
        with pytest.raises(ValueError):
            azure.set_expiry(a, 'BadEnumValue')

        # missing time
        with pytest.raises(ValueError):
            azure.set_expiry(a, 'Absolute')
